SNA and Jubbaland Forces Inflict Heavy Losses on Al-Shabaab in Juba Regions Offensive

Mogadishu, SONNA — The Somali National Army (SNA), in coordination with Jubbaland Security Forces, is conducting a large-scale military operation across parts of the Lower and Middle Juba regions, targeting Al-Shabaab militants in key strongholds.

The ongoing operations are concentrated in areas under the districts of Jilib, Xagar, and Afmadow, including Waraha Qalley, Farshabeel, Jigees, Qawiley, and Weelmaarow, where ground forces have advanced to dismantle militant positions.

According to security officials, the offensive has been reinforced by coordinated airstrikes carried out with the support of international partners, significantly intensifying pressure on militant hideouts in the region.

The operation has resulted in a major setback for Al-Shabaab, with 27 insurgents killed, including senior members of the group.

Forces also seized a cache of weapons and military equipment, including BKM machine guns, RPG launchers, AK-47 rifles, and explosive devices intended for attacks against civilians and security personnel.

Military officials confirmed that operations are ongoing, with efforts focused on clearing remaining militant elements and consolidating security gains across the Juba regions.

The Somali National Army reaffirmed its commitment to continuing operations aimed at ensuring long-term stability, security, and the protection of civilians.
